• Login
  • Register
  • Zoek
This Thread
  • Everywhere
  • This Thread
  • This Forum
  • Articles
  • Pages
  • Forum
  • Filebase Entry
  • More Options

ICTscripters

Dé plek voor IT

Dé plek voor IT

Login

Geavanceerde opties
  1. Home
  2. Forum
    1. Alle berichten
    2. Recente activiteiten
  3. ICT Nieuws
  4. Blog
  5. Marktplaats
    1. Werk
    2. Advertenties
    3. Domeinnamen
    4. Websites
    5. Design & lay-outs
    6. Scripts
    7. Overige
  6. Design
  7. Leden
    1. Actieve bezoekers
    2. Team
    3. Leden zoeken
  8. Downloads
  9. Goedkope domeinnamen
  1. Home
  2. Forum
    1. Alle berichten
    2. Recente activiteiten
  3. ICT Nieuws
  4. Blog
  5. Marktplaats
    1. Werk
    2. Advertenties
    3. Domeinnamen
    4. Websites
    5. Design & lay-outs
    6. Scripts
    7. Overige
  6. Design
  7. Leden
    1. Actieve bezoekers
    2. Team
    3. Leden zoeken
  8. Downloads
  9. Goedkope domeinnamen
  1. Home
  2. Forum
    1. Alle berichten
    2. Recente activiteiten
  3. ICT Nieuws
  4. Blog
  5. Marktplaats
    1. Werk
    2. Advertenties
    3. Domeinnamen
    4. Websites
    5. Design & lay-outs
    6. Scripts
    7. Overige
  6. Design
  7. Leden
    1. Actieve bezoekers
    2. Team
    3. Leden zoeken
  8. Downloads
  9. Goedkope domeinnamen
  1. Dé plek voor IT - ICTscripters
  2. Forum
  3. Scripting & programmeren
  4. PHP + SQL

Forum

  • Beta-testers gezocht voor Crypto-oefenplatform

    Syntax 29 januari 2026 om 16:11
  • Na 15 jaar terug van weggeweest: iCriminals.nl is terug (BETA)!

    Syntax 19 januari 2026 om 09:34
  • Developer Gezocht

    Mikevdk 10 januari 2026 om 18:57
  • Op zoek naar de legends

    Syntax 5 januari 2026 om 13:50
  • [FREE] WeFact Hosting module

    Jeroen.G 13 oktober 2025 om 14:09
  • Help testers nodig voor android app Urgent

    urgentotservices 26 september 2025 om 10:21
  • Versio vervanger

    Jeroen.G 25 augustus 2025 om 15:56
  • Afspraken systeem met planbeperking

    Lijno 1 augustus 2025 om 23:04

Marktplaats

  • 321 Nieuwe Domeinnamen December 2025

    shiga 1 januari 2026 om 10:26
  • Meerdere mafia game template te koop

    Syntax 26 december 2025 om 00:07
  • Van een pixelige afbeelding naar een strakke, moderne website

    Syntax 21 december 2025 om 17:05

Wie gebruikt er...?

  • Tim
  • 4 juni 2011 om 01:06
  • Tim
    Enlightened
    Ontvangen Reacties
    77
    Berichten
    3.686
    • 4 juni 2011 om 01:06
    • #1

    Hallo,

    Ik had eerder een topic gestart over wie er allemaal aan OOP deed. Ik vond dat het uiteindelijk een interessante topic werd.

    Nu wil ik een discussie starten rondom de Join functie van MySQL.

    Wat doet deze functie?
    Hierbij kan je informatie ophalen uit meer dan één tabel tegelijk en/of een bepaalde row selecteren aan de hand van één of meerdere tabellen in één query.
    Het voordeel? Minder werk en minder load voor de database aangezien je maar één query doet in plaats van meerdere.

    Ikzelf heb vandaag het eens geprobeerd na lange tijd. Het werkt erg fijn. Het scheelt inderdaad extra werk. Maar ik vind de documentatie wel lastig en niet overzichtelijk. Ik ben zelf dus eigenlijk ook een beetje "nieuw" op dat gebied al ken ik de functie wel.

    Nu is dus mijn vraag:
    - Gebruik je het?
    - Zo nee, waarom niet? Zo ja, waarom wel?
    - Kende je deze functie?
    - Indien je deze niet kende, ga je er naar kijken?

    Master student IT-recht en Master student Ondernemingsrecht & software ingenieur
    My Personal profile
    My professional profile (LinkedIn/CV)

  • Guest, wil je besparen op je domeinnamen? (ad)
  • Malik
    Guest
    • 4 juni 2011 om 07:07
    • #2

    Ik gebruik het nog niet, omdat ik het nog niet goed heb bekeken hoe en waar ik het goed kan gebruiken.

    Ik kende de functie wel en vond hem geniaal! :cheer:

  • Stefan.J
    Master
    Ontvangen Reacties
    9
    Berichten
    2.358
    • 4 juni 2011 om 09:51
    • #3

    JOIN is maar een van de vele krachtige functionaliteiten van SQL. Belangrijk is dat er verschillende soorten JOIN's bestaan, wat het beste is toe te lichten aan de hand van een voorbeeld:

    SELECT * FROM linker [JOIN] rechter ON linker.voorwaarde = rechter.voorwaarde

    Als op de plek van [JOIN] staat:
    - INNER JOIN: Join alle rijen van linker met alle rijen van rechter waarvoor linker.voorwaarde gelijk is aan rechter.voorwaarde.
    - RIGHT OUTER JOIN: Selecteer alle rijen van rechter, en join deze waar mogelijk met linker. Wanneer er geen join wordt gevonden wordt het record uit rechter wel toegevoegd aan het eindresultaat, met NULL waarden voor de kolommen uit linker.
    - LEFT OUTER JOIN: Selecteer alle rijen van linker, en join deze waar mogelijk met rechter. Wanneer er geen join wordt gevonden wordt het record uit linker wel toegevoegd aan het eindresultaat, met NULL waarden voor de kolommen uit rechter.

  • Luc
    Software Engineer
    Ontvangen Reacties
    44
    Berichten
    1.986
    • 4 juni 2011 om 13:26
    • #4

    Ik gebruik joins al 3 kwart jaar. Vindt ze erg handig werken en heb er zelfs artikelen over geschreven die naar mijn mening lekker duidelijk zijn.

    Verder kan je met JOINS ook extra selecten uitvoeren binnen een JOIN.

    PHP
    mysql_query("SELECT user.id FROM user 
    INNER JOIN(SELECT profile.id ON(user.id=profile.userID))");

    Dit is even snel geschreven en niet getest of het zo klopte maar volgens mij werkte het zo met extra SELECT.

    Groeten,

    Luc

    Website: https://devimo.nl
    Skype: https://join.skype.com/invite/dJyYILTt7Eqh

  • Tim
    Enlightened
    Ontvangen Reacties
    77
    Berichten
    3.686
    • 4 juni 2011 om 13:31
    • #5

    Waar kan ik het artikel lezen?

    Master student IT-recht en Master student Ondernemingsrecht & software ingenieur
    My Personal profile
    My professional profile (LinkedIn/CV)

  • DevIT
    Beginner
    Berichten
    26
    • 4 juni 2011 om 14:11
    • #6

    Ik heb t laast voor t eerst leren gebruiken en Killingdevil heeft precies de uitleg gegeven die ik nodig had:)

  • GijsB
    Beginner
    Berichten
    26
    • 5 juni 2011 om 14:14
    • #7

    Ik gebruik het. Waarom behoeft geen uitleg zeker? Minder querys is op een pagina is beter.. En ik kende de functie inderdaad al.

    Iedereen die het nog niet kent raad ik dan ook aan er gewoon eens naar de te kijken, gewoon weg omdat het bij grote websites duidelijk merkbaar is wanneer er goed of slecht naar de databasestructuur gekeken is.

  • iCold
    Professional
    Ontvangen Reacties
    7
    Berichten
    1.630
    • 5 juni 2011 om 19:43
    • #8

    Ik gebruik ook een lange tijd join. Tis veel handiger (vind ik). Miss heb hier hier wat aan:

    http://www.tizag.com/sqlTutorial/sqljoin.php

Participate now!

Heb je nog geen account? Registreer je nu en word deel van onze community!

Maak een account aan Login

ICT Nieuws

  • Fijne feestdagen

    tcbhome 28 december 2025 om 13:55
  • Kritieke update voor Really Simple Security-plug-in

    K.Rens 16 november 2024 om 16:12
  • ING Nederland streeft naar ondersteuning van Google Pay tegen eind februari

    K.Rens 2 november 2024 om 16:09

Blogs

  • Functioneel ontwerp

    Dees 28 december 2014 om 12:38
  • Access Control List implementatie in PHP/MySQL - deel 1/2

    FangorN 28 december 2018 om 12:35
  • Access Control List implementatie in PHP/MySQL - deel 2/2

    FangorN 29 december 2018 om 12:37
  1. Marktplaats
  2. Design
  3. Voorwaarden
  4. Ons team
  5. Leden
  6. Geschiedenis
  7. Regels
  8. Links
  9. Privacy Policy
ICTscripters ©2005 - 2026 , goedkope hosting door DiMoWeb.com, BE0558.915.582
Sponsors: Beste kattenhotel provincie Antwerpen | Beste Zetes eid kaartlezer webshop
Style: Nexus by cls-design
Stylename
Nexus
Manufacturer
cls-design
Licence
Commercial styles
Help
Supportforum
Visit cls-design